


Set in spectacular scenic surroundings near the town of Marken, the 4 500 hectare provincial park is a joint venture between the Limpopo government and the Bakenberg community in which all stakeholders are working together to promote tourism-driven economic development.
The variety of rock formation, vegetation and rivers make this reserve exceptionally beautiful. wildlife species encountered regularly includes sable, tsessebe, giraffe, zebra, nyala, eland kudu, leopard and others. Besides the renovated camp for visitors and the conference centre, this reserve is also proud host of an Ivory Route Camp.
